A bar (wih bending rigidity EI) is supported at A and B with length 2a. The bar is fixed at B (length=2a) with a pin support at A (length L=0). Additionally, at A is a torsion spring (spring constant Ca = EI/a) and an extension spring is attached at B (spring constant Cb = EI/(a^3)). In the unloaded state, both springs are relaxed. What is the moment in the torsion spring when a force F is applied to the middle of the beam (L=a)?
